Abstract

At present, the influence of the network, which has obtained a rapid development, may have changed the behavior patterns, the value orientation, and the psychological development and moral values of the students at the higher learning schools. In this paper, from the perspectives of the negative network environment and the characteristics of the students at the higher learning schools, the authors conduct an analysis on the influences of the negative network environment on the value orientation of the students at multiple aspects. Hence, this paper can provide a powerful theoretical and practical foundation for the educational workers at the higher learning schools to strengthen the education and guidance to their students.
